Output 2e39d5136ef2c52243fcbe6966cf92a7e05b3e5d096578d0ea35a1899c1237ba:0

value
2685477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bad3478d94eb015aeef3220af2a873a110175c60 OP_EQUAL
address
MQw124tqK5NFT3JdMAUs3VfdcEBMJU7KKN
transaction
2e39d5136ef2c52243fcbe6966cf92a7e05b3e5d096578d0ea35a1899c1237ba
spent
true